Internet business directories began as the online equivalent of printed business listings, which simply transferred onto the internet as it became more widely used. They were a major influence on getting businesses exposure and were an essential place to be listed if you wanted potential customers to find your business. However, as search engines developed and users started searching for exactly what they wanted rather than going to a directory, there was some doubt as to whether they remained relevant.
